Understanding Data Structures and Algorithms:
Data structures and algorithms are the building blocks of computer science. Data structures refer to how computers represent and organize information, while algorithms are the step-by-step instructions that allow computers to process data efficiently. Together, they form the backbone of programming and software engineering.

Actionable Advice for Learning Data Structures and Algorithms:
-
Start with the Basics: Begin your journey by familiarizing yourself with fundamental data structures such as arrays, linked lists, stacks, and queues. Understanding how these structures operate and their associated algorithms will lay a solid foundation for further learning.
-
Practice, Practice, Practice: Solving coding problems regularly is the key to mastering data structures and algorithms. Websites like LeetCode, HackerRank, and CodeSignal provide an array of coding challenges that allow you to sharpen your problem-solving skills and apply your knowledge in a practical setting.
-
Dive into Open-Source Projects: Contributing to open-source projects exposes you to real-world scenarios and collaborative programming. By working on projects with experienced developers, you can gain valuable insights, improve your coding skills, and apply data structures and algorithms in a practical context.
